The SHA-2 and SHA-three family of cryptographic hash features are protected and suggested alternate options to the MD5 message-digest algorithm. They're much extra resistant to likely collisions and generate genuinely one of a kind hash values.
One essential prerequisite of any cryptographic hash operate is the fact that it ought to be computationally infeasible to seek out two distinct messages that hash to precisely the same value. MD5 fails this prerequisite catastrophically. On 31 December 2008, the CMU Software program Engineering Institute concluded that MD5 was fundamentally "cryptographically broken and unsuitable for even more use".

Adhering to during the footsteps of MD2 and MD4, MD5 generates a 128-little bit hash value. Its key purpose get more info is usually to validate that a file is unaltered.
MD5 can be not the only option for password hashing. Given the algorithm's speed—that's a toughness in other contexts—it permits fast brute power assaults.
